Where does “tauromaquia” come from?
tauromaquia (Galician) comes from Ancient Greek μάχη, from Ancient Greek μάχομαι, from Proto-Indo-European maHgʰ- — to fight.
tauromaquia (Galician): tauromachy, bullfighting
Ancestry of “tauromaquia”, step by step
| Step | Language | Word | Meaning |
|---|
| 1 | Ancient Greek | μάχη | battle, combat; quarrel, strife, dispute;... |
| 2 | Ancient Greek | μάχομαι | I make war, fight, battle; I quarrel, wrangle,... |
| 3 | Proto-Indo-European | maHgʰ- | to fight |
